test_that(".check_arrow correctly detects arrow availability", {
# Mock both R and Python arrow are available
testthat::local_mocked_bindings(
requireNamespace = function(...) TRUE,
.package = "base"
)
testthat::local_mocked_bindings(
py_module_available = function(...) TRUE,
.package = "reticulate"
)
# Test when both R and Python arrow are available
result <- .check_arrow()
expect_length(result, 2)
expect_true(result["r"])
expect_true(result["python"])
# Test when R arrow is not available
testthat::local_mocked_bindings(
requireNamespace = function(...) FALSE,
.package = "base"
)
result <- .check_arrow()
expect_false(result["r"])
expect_true(result["python"])
# Test when Python arrow is not available
testthat::local_mocked_bindings(
py_module_available = function(...) FALSE,
.package = "reticulate"
)
result <- .check_arrow()
expect_false(result["r"])
expect_false(result["python"])
})
